From 5ff508093503f531edfac6723feef17848712bdd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=D0=9B=D0=B5=D0=BE=D0=BD=D0=B8=D0=B4=20=D0=AE=D1=80=D1=8C?= =?UTF-8?q?=D0=B5=D0=B2=20=28Leonid=20Yuriev=29?= Date: Sat, 28 Dec 2024 09:52:19 +0300 Subject: [PATCH] =?UTF-8?q?mdbx:=20=D0=B4=D0=BE=D0=BF=D0=BE=D0=BB=D0=BD?= =?UTF-8?q?=D0=B5=D0=BD=D0=B8=D0=B5=20ChangeLog.?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- ChangeLog.md | 10 ++++++++++ 1 file changed, 10 insertions(+) diff --git a/ChangeLog.md b/ChangeLog.md index f1b77857..c055445e 100644 --- a/ChangeLog.md +++ b/ChangeLog.md @@ -77,6 +77,16 @@ and [by Yandex](https://translated.turbopages.org/proxy_u/ru-en.en/https/libmdbx - В утилите тестирования значение режима данных переименовано из `data.dups` в `data.multi`. + - Доработан контроль длины ключа внутри `cursor_seek()`. + + Ранее проверка внутри `cursor_seek()` не позволяла искать ключи длиннее, чем можно поместить в таблицу. + Однако, при поиске/позиционировании это не является ошибкой для таблиц с ключами переменного размера. + + - Если посредством `mdbx_env_set_option(MDBX_opt_txn_dp_limit)` пользователем не задано собственно значение, + то выполняется подстройка dirty-pages-limit при старте каждой не-вложенной пишущей транзакций, + исходя из объёма доступного ОЗУ и размера БД. + + --------------------------------------------------------------------------------